If only they hadn’t left, Modrić and Berbatov could have led Tottenham into a golden era. At their peak, they were artistry and intelligence blended with ruthless execution—Modrić pulling the strings in midfield with unmatched vision, and Berbatov up front, turning every touch into poetry. Spurs had the foundations of a truly world-class side, but as always, timing and ambition didn’t quite align.

 

Modrić, destined for greatness, eventually found his place among the world’s best at Real Madrid, becoming a Ballon d’Or winner and Champions League legend. Berbatov, equally elegant, moved to Manchester United and collected titles Spurs could only dream of. Imagine those two, backed by a growing squad, staying just a bit longer—teaching, inspiring, elevating. Tottenham could’ve built something sustainable around their calm dominance.

Instead, we were left wondering what could have been. The club grew, yes, but too late for that duo. In a parallel universe, maybe Modrić is lifting silverware in a white shirt that says Tottenham, and Berbatov is weaving through defenders at Wembley, not Old Trafford. They were more than just talent—they were the dream that slipped away too soon.
